5. 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S
a. Evidence of Certificate of Incorporation issued by the Corporate Affairs Commission (CAC) including Form CAC 1.1 OR CAC 2 AND CAC 7 OR 2025 Status Report.
b. Evidence of Company’s Income Tax Clearance Certificate for the last three (3) years valid till 31st December 2025. TCC must have minimum average turnover as indicated in the advertisement and bill of quantities. Non-compliance would lead to disqualification.
c. Evidence of Pension Clearance Certificate valid till 31st December 2025;
d. Evidence of Industrial Training Fund (ITF) Compliance Certificate valid till 31st December 2025;
e. Evidence of Nigeria Social Insurance Trust Fund (NSITF) Clearance Certificate valid till 31st December 2025;
f. Evidence of Registration on the National Database of Federal Contractors, Consultants and Service Providers by submission of Interim Registration Report (IRR) expiring on 31st December 2025.
g. Sworn Affidavit, duly signed by the deponent dated within the advertisement period:
– stating whether or not any officer of the relevant committees of Jos University Teaching Hospital or Bureau of Public procurement is a former or present Director, shareholder or has any pecuniary interest in the bidder and to confirm that all information presented in its bid are true and correct in all particulars;
– that no Director of the company has been convicted in any Country for any criminal offence relating to fraud or financial impropriety or criminal misrepresentation or falsification of facts relating to any matter;
– that the Company is not in receivership, the subject of any form of insolvency or bankruptcy proceedings or the subject of any form of winding up petition or proceedings;
h. Company’s unabridged Audited Accounts for immediate past three (3) years – 2022, 2023 & 2024. The seal and registration number of the Auditing firm MUST be on the Audited report;
i. Bank Reference Letter addressed to the Chief Medical Director, JUTH from a reputable commercial bank in Nigeria, indicating willingness to provide credit facility for the execution of the project when needed, dated within the advertisement period;
j. Company’s Profile indicating its activities, with the Curriculum Vitae of Key Staff to be deployed for the project (Architect, Building Engineer, Quantity Surveyor, Electrical Engineer, Mechanical Engineer for WORKS Only), including copies of their Academic/Professional qualifications such as COREN, QSRBN, ARCON, CORBON etc.;
k. Verifiable documentary evidence of at least three (3) similar jobs executed in the last five (5) years including Letters of Awards, Valuation Certificates for completed projects and Photographs of the projects; (For Category ‘A’-WORKS only). Supplies would require only award letters and job completion certificates.
l. List of Plants/Equipment with proof of Ownership or Lease Agreement, (For Category ‘A’-WORKS only)
m. Letter of Authorisation from the Original Equipment Manufacturers listed in the Approved Policy for Procurement of Health and Medical Equipment for Tertiary Hospitals in Nigeria, for bidders bidding Health/Medical Equipment and Machines (For Category ‘B’-GOODS);
n. Medical Outreach Consultancy: The personnel of the company must include evidence as Registered/Licensed Doctors, Medical laboratory Scientist, Nurses and Pharmacists.
o. Construction Consultancy: The personnel of the company must include evidence as Registered/Licensed Building Engineers, Architects, Mechanical Engineers and Quantity Surveyors with a minimum of Six (6) years’ experience.
p. All documents for submission must be transmitted with a Covering/Forwarding letter under the Company/Firm’s Letter Head Paper bearing amongst others, the Registration Number (RC) as issued by the Corporate Affairs Commission (CAC), Contact Address, Telephone Number (preferably GSM No.), and functional e-mail address. The Letterhead Paper must bear the Names and Nationalities of the Directors of the Company at the bottom of the page, duly signed by the authorized officer of the firm.

All documents/information MUST be arranged and submitted in the strict sequence listed above and paginated, with a table of contents indicating the pages where requested documents can be found, failure to do so would lead to disqualification.
